Output e559dde340323d6581fde8a9ceadcc32cb23f7b7082305115a2fdb26423dc25f:0

value
21173433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a57692f4eff9c5b2cf1906bf643cd5ab0179e0 OP_EQUAL
address
3F9hUKsJ6aNuxPsyWxrCRPqhLjHij1jwRn
transaction
e559dde340323d6581fde8a9ceadcc32cb23f7b7082305115a2fdb26423dc25f
spent
true